The desired focus of the position is the influence of land-sea interactions on the well-being and sustainability of coastal natural resources and communities. These interactions relate to a wide range of challenges facing Florida’s coastal environment, including harmful algal blooms, eutrophication, hypoxia, climate change, sea level rise, pollutants, hydrologic and physical alterations, and habitat losses. These and other challenges, in turn, affect coastal resources and communities, including fisheries, tourism, property values, recreational activities, natural hazard risks and human health.
